Modballs adds to its Happy Wholesome snack lineup
The bites contain 8 g of protein and at least 5 g of fiber.

Two new Happy Wholesome flavors have arrived from Modballs, the brand reportedly known for its poppable protein balls made with simple ingredients. The newest additions—Chocolate Cherry and Apple Cinnamon—join consumer-favorites Peanut Butter Chocolate and Almond Coconut Chocolate, giving snackers even more ways to fuel their day, the brand says. The new flavors are all available on Amazon, Modballs.com, and on shelf at Harmon's Neighborhood Grocers in Utah.
Each serving delivers 8 g of protein and at least 5 g of fiber, and each ball has less than 100 calories. The bites are individually wrapped for freshness and portability, and made with whole food ingredients.
Founded by a father and food scientist, the brand was created with the goal of making a more delicious and nutritious snack to fuel busy families.
Modballs are gluten-free, non-GMO, and made without high fructose corn syrup, preservatives, or soy.
